Training Efficiency and Precision

DeepSeek employs FP8 precision, which enhances training efficiency by reducing computational requirements without compromising performance. This contrasts with ChatGPT’s FP16 precision, which, while powerful, demands more resources. DeepSeek’s approach not only lowers costs but also accelerates the training process, making it a more sustainable option for continuous learning and adaptation.

Economic Viability

When it comes to operational costs, DeepSeek offers a more economical solution. With input costs at $0.14 per million tokens and output costs at $0.28 per million tokens, it is significantly more affordable than ChatGPT, which charges $2.50 and $10.00 per million tokens for input and output, respectively. This cost efficiency makes DeepSeek an attractive option for large-scale and resource-intensive applications.
